Stanbury Wharf;Swifts Barn
Much history is associated with this cottage and former wharf, which lie alongside the now dry Holsworthy to Bude Canal. Imaginatively renovated and set in 1 tranquil acres, they boast enclosed gardens and electronic gates designed with privacy and safety of children and pets in mind. Within walking distance are shops, inns and vibrant street and livestock markets in the thriving town of Holsworthy. The surrounding countryside, near the Cornish border, is part of the peaceful hinterland known as 'Ruby Country', which offers miles of new riding, cycling and walking trails. There is a acre fishing lake where coarse fishing can be enjoyed free of charge on the owners' farm, 1 miles away, whilst the Tamar Lakes (about 6 miles) offer tuition in sailing, windsurfing and canoeing as well as waymarked walks, picnic areas and fishing. Bude's magnificent beaches, indoor splash pool and myriad amenities are 9 miles. There is easy access to Dartmoor, north Devon's superb beaches and picturesque Cornish fishing villages of Tintagel, Boscastle and Padstow, whilst the Eden Project is 1 hours' drive.
